Can someone tell which Ride cymbal this is? Sounds amazing.
This is in fact one of the 3 prototype rides that Jan Axel (Hellhammer) had when he was still at Sabian - it is a Vault Prototype ride. As far as i know Jan still has one, the other one is this one (Oyvind) and the third one is with Jon (Sekaran ex-DHG).
Thank you very much for the reply. There aint nothing better than a descent ride cymbal. Cutting Like a blade
@@thedeceased Yea this one is pretty heavy as a construction. Its quite dark close to the leopard ride that Jan likes and i have and like as well but with the huge bell from the power bell ride. Its quite interesting :-)
